To understand what a "Ghost Eye Remote Spotlight Exclusive" could represent, we have to look at the individual technological components commonly associated with these terms: 1. "Ghost Eye"

In modern technology and surveillance, "Ghost Eye" generally refers to one of three things:

Advanced Radar Systems: Several defense contractors use "Ghost Eye" as a moniker for radar systems capable of detecting low-visibility or "stealth" targets (such as drones or stealth aircraft) that otherwise act as "ghosts" on standard radar.

Optical/Night Vision Sensors: It can refer to high-sensitivity thermal or infrared cameras capable of seeing in pitch-black conditions, effectively piercing the darkness to reveal hidden subjects.

Biometric Surveillance: Media sometimes use terms like "Ghost" or "Ghost Murmur" to describe highly advanced, low-trace remote biometric scanners that can identify individuals from afar without their knowledge. 2. "Remote Spotlight"

This is a literal and widely used piece of hardware in both commercial and tactical fields:

Tactical & Hunting Applications: Motorized spotlights mounted on top of vehicles. They are controlled remotely via a joystick or wireless remote from inside the cabin, allowing operators to scan large fields at night without leaving the vehicle.

Search and Rescue (SAR): Drones or helicopters equipped with high-intensity LED or halogen spotlights that can be panned, tilted, and focused remotely by an operator on the ground or in the cockpit. 3. "Exclusive"

In a technical or corporate paper, "exclusive" typically signifies:

Proprietary Technology: A patented design or system execution held entirely by one manufacturer.

Restricted Use: Equipment reserved strictly for military, intelligence, or law enforcement applications, not available on the civilian market.

While "Ghost Eye Remote Spotlight Exclusive" does not refer to a single, standalone consumer product, it typically describes a specialized category of motorized remote-controlled spotlights used in high-intensity environments like marine operations, off-roading, and professional security. Core Technology and Features

The term often highlights a combination of advanced illumination and remote dexterity. Precision Motorization: These spotlights, such as the Golight GT Series Go to product viewer dialog for this item.

, feature high-torque drive trains allowing for 360° to 370° of horizontal rotation and up to 135° of vertical tilt. Benefits of the Ghost Eye Remote Spotlight Exclusive

Long-Range Output: Top-tier models utilize "Exclusive GXL LED Technology" or high-wattage Cree LEDs to produce upwards of 225,000 candle power, capable of reaching distances over 3,000 feet.

Wireless Versatility: Systems generally include programmable wireless remotes that operate within a range of up to 328 feet (100 meters), ensuring users can adjust lighting from inside a vehicle or a safe distance. Primary Applications

These high-powered lights are "exclusive" to demanding sectors due to their rugged builds and specialized functions:

Public Safety & Security: Agencies use them for patrol vehicles to illuminate "blind spots" during night shifts or to synchronize with vehicle emergency systems for sweeping patterns like intersection clearing.

Marine & Tactical: Built with UV ray and saltwater resistance (IP56 or IP67 ratings), they are essential for yacht operations, coast guards, and search-and-rescue missions in harsh environments.

Outdoor Community: Specialized versions include Infrared (IR) LED options, which are highly valued in the predator hunting community when paired with night vision to remain undetected while navigating or tracking. Design and Durability

To survive extreme conditions, these spotlights are often constructed with shock-proof solid-state lighting and impact-resistant thermoplastic shells. Installation is flexible, offering permanent mount options for heavy-duty vehicles or portable magnetic bases for temporary use.

Ghost Eye Remote Spotlight (also referred to as the Moondyne Ghost Eye) is a specialized remote-controlled lighting system used primarily for night hunting and feral pest management. Product Overview

The Ghost Eye is an Australian-designed remote spotlight system favored by hunters for its effectiveness in removing feral pests like foxes and pigs. It is often used on vehicle-mounted setups or dedicated scanning platforms for nighttime field operations. Primary Use

: Professional and recreational night hunting and pest eradication. Key Advantage

: Allows operators to control the direction and movement of a powerful spotlight remotely, often from inside a vehicle or a scanning station. Compatibility
